Course Goal / Objective

To provide mathematical basic information necessary for analyzing and solving computer programming related problems

Course Content

Numbers and clusters,Algebra,Equations and Inequalities,Sequence and series,Functions,Exponential functions and logarithm,Statistics,Derivative

Course Learning Outcomes

Order Course Learning Outcomes
LO01 Learn and apply mathematical basic knowledge necessary for analyzing and solving computer programming problems
LO02 Learn to solve problems related to numbers and clusters
LO03 Learn to solve problems related to equations and inequalities.
LO04 Learn to solve problems related to functions and logarithms.
LO05 Learn statistical solutions.
